Imagine traveling from New York to Los Angeles in less than an hour or from London to Paris in 15 minutes.\u00a0<\/p>\n
Sounds impossible, right? Well, not for China\u2019s biggest missile manufacturer, which claims to have built the fastest train ever.<\/p>\n
The China Aerospace Science and Industry Corporation (CASIC) has been working on a hyperloop train that can hit incredibly high speeds in a vacuum.\u00a0<\/p>\n
The idea is to take a confined tube \u2013 big enough to fit a train \u2013 and suck all the air out so that there\u2019s no air drag to slow you down.<\/p>\n
